Not really.As you are probably finding out the Larish clan is hard to pin down.There is one Elizabeth that might fit that time frame, however. At least, she is the only one I have in my paper file (I don't put anybody in my familytreemaker file until I get all the this and thats and connections to my family's tree)that just might fit.She would be the daughter of Rudolph Larish and his wife Elizabetha.Rudolph is the son of Ludwig Larosche and his wife, Anna Cunigunda Schaadin.Rudolph is listed in the 1790 census for Macungie Township in Northampton Co., PA (later Lehigh).But in his will, dated 1806, he mentions her as being the wife of Michael Breith (Breusch).Of course, people were widowed and remarried etc.Ludwig had other sons, Nicholas, Henry, Joseph and Jacob.But I can only find evidence of Joseph and Rudolph's children's names.Keep looking and please share any and all discoveries!!!
